Essential component of the ubiquitin-dependent proteolytic pathway which degrades ubiquitin fusion proteins.
The ternary complex containing UFD1L, VCP and NPLOC4 binds ubiquitinated proteins and is necessary for the export of misfolded proteins from the ER to the cytoplasm, where they are degraded by the proteasome.
The NPLOC4-UFD1L-VCP complex regulates spindle disassembly at the end of mitosis and is necessary for the formation of a closed nuclear envelope.
It may be involved in the development of some ectoderm-derived structures.
